.png) Các cách đọc giờ trong tiếng Anh Cách đọc giờ trong tiếng Anh sẽ chia làm 5 cách chính sau đây: Cách đọc giờ đúng/giờ trònGiờ đúng là những giờ bắt đầu (0 Phút) một khung giờ (60 phút) mới. Ví dụ như 3 giờ 00 phút, 5 giờ 00 phút,… Cách đọc như sau: Số giờ + “o’clock”. Trong đó: Số giờ là bằng số đếm bình thường: One, two, three, four...+ O’clock : /əˈklɒk/ Ví dụ:
Cách đọc giờ hơn Giờ hơn là những giờ có số phút không quá 30. Ví dụ như 10 giờ 10 phút, 8 giờ 5 phút,… Giờ hơn có 2 cách đọc: Trong đó: số phút và số được được đọc bằng số đếm thông thường. Ví dụ:
Cách số 2: phút + “past” + giờ Trong đó: Số phút và số giờ được được đọc bằng số đếm. Ví dụ:
Cách đọc giờ kém trong tiếng AnhGiờ kém là những giờ có số phút sắp chuyển qua khung giờ mới hay lớn hơn 30 phút. Ví dụ như 5 giờ 37 phút, 8 giờ 47 phút,... Cách đọc sẽ là: Số phút + “to” + (số giờ +1) Trong đó: Số phút và số giờ được đọc bằng số đếm. Ví dụ:
Cách đọc giờ đặc biệtKhi đọc giờ có số phút bằng 15 và 45, người ta sẽ dùng: (a) quarter past/to. Trong đó: (a) quarter [‘kwɔrtər] là a quarter of an hour (một phần tư một giờ). Ví dụ:
Khi đọc giờ có số phút là 30, người ta thường dùng: half past + giờ. Trong đó: Half past là nửa tiếng. Ví dụ:
Về buổi trong ngàyKhi muốn nói đến một giờ cụ thể, nhất là khi đọc giờ đúng hay giờ hơn theo cách 1, chúng ta cần xác định rõ đó là buổi sáng hay buổi chiều. Việc này thực hiện dễ dàng bằng cách thêm a.m nếu là buổi sáng, p.m nếu là buổi chiều. Ví dụ:

In this article, we’ll see the definition of quarter-hours from a mathematical perspective and learn to tell quarter times. Related GamesWhat Is One Quarter of an Hour?One hour equals 60 minutes. If we divide one hour into four equal parts, each part is called a quarter of an hour and equals 15 minutes. Thus, one quarter of an hour means 14th of 60 minutes or simply 15 minutes. Related WorksheetsQuarters: DefinitionThe word “quarter” comes from the old French “quartier,” meaning a fourth. Therefore, “quarter” refers to one of the four equal divisions of something. A quarter is 14th of a dollar and 14th of a yard. There are four quarters in a typical American football game and four quarts in a gallon. A quarter in time refers to a fourth of a time block. For instance, a quarter of four hours is an hour. A quarter of eight hours is two hours. What Is a Quarter of an Hour?A quarter hour refers to a fourth of an hour. If we divide an hour into four equal time patches, each would equal a quarter-hour. How Long Is a Quarter of an Hour?One hour is 60 minutes. So, a quarter hour is 14th of 60, i.e., 15 minutes. Therefore, a quarter hour refers to fifteen minutes. Analog Clocks and Digital ClocksDigital clocks show us the exact time in hours and minutes. However, in analog clocks, we have to understand the time by looking at the positions of the hour and minute hands. In this section, we’ll try to convert the time in analog clocks to digital form. Quarter-hour Fractions in Analog ClocksWe can divide an analog clock into four equal parts. Each part represents a quarter time. Concerning its minute hand, each part represents a quarter hour. Example 2: The clock below shows the passing of a quarter-hour from 12. Telling Time: Quarter HourWe can tell quarter times in two ways. Let’s see each of them. Quarter Past“Quarter past” refers to a quarter-hour past (after) the given time. For instance, quarter past eight refers to 15 minutes after 8 or 8:15. Observe that in a quarter past the hour, the hour hand will be slightly ahead of the number. Quarter To“Quarter to” refers to a quarter-hour to (before) the given time. For instance, quarter to eleven refers to 15 minutes to 11 or 10:45. Observe that in quarter to an hour the hour hand will be slightly behind the number. I’m a clock, My hands race. ConclusionA quarter hour is a unit of time that is equal to a quarter (one-fourth) of an hour or 60 minutes. Knowing the concept of a quarter hour thus helps in telling time, reading time and calculating time. Solved Examples1. What is the time shown in the clock below? Solution: In the figure, the hour hand of the clock is at 1. So, the hour component of the digital time is also 1. Also, on the clock, the minute hand is at 3. So, the minute component of the digital time is 3 x 5 = 15. So, the time is 3:15 or 15 minutes past 1. We can write it as a quarter past one. 2. Write the digital time of ‘quarter to five’. Solution: 15 minutes to 5 is 4:45. 3. What is two quarters of an hour in minutes? Solution: A quarter-hour is 15 minutes. So, two quarters will be 30 minutes or half an hour. 4. Frequently Asked QuestionsNo. A quarter-hour is 15 minutes. 30 minutes will be two quarters or half an hour. What percentage of an hour is a quarter-hour? A quarter-hour is 1/4th or 25% of an hour. Is a quarter past the hour the fourth quarter? No. A quarter past the hour is the first quarter. Half past the hour is the second, three quarters past the hour is the third, and a quarter to the hour is the fourth quarter. |
